Output 24f3e11508195886615335caf94a734666785d1145dd223636821dd007ffebb9:1

value
86780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58400d99e8914d421a34e938b98e8617a06ce1fd OP_EQUALVERIFY OP_CHECKSIG
address
193dCNVY15mMP4D8jDZs1shJhdUthGmDMK
transaction
24f3e11508195886615335caf94a734666785d1145dd223636821dd007ffebb9
spent
true